We're looking for a dynamic team member, with a thorough and enquiring approach to design to join our expanding team in Farringdon. You will be central to shaping and developing a core client through design.

The challenges will be highly varied – and you’ll be able to flex across timelines ranging from the shorter term solves, to the long-term exploratory exercises. 

 

Collaboration is in our DNA and you will be someone who enjoys making meaningful and effective contributions.

The role provides a chance to create brilliant design and continue to develop your skills across deliveries and design systems, all within a talented, passionate, and supportive team. Likewise, you can be an inspiring force for the whole team in the pursuit of the very best results and brilliant design.

 

You will be well versed across the creative suite of tools, having experienced delivering a high level of design craft across traditional media and digital. Motion design skills are a nice-to-have additional.

 

Our ideal designer would be an optimist that’s positive about the power of design to really moves brands forwards. Someone who lives and breathes design of all kinds and will have experienced creative agency settings previously.

Whether for existing clients or new business pitches, our perfect candidate will demonstrate an ability to:

Own brand design guardianship for our clients’ sub-brands, working across various visual identities.

Under guidance of senior team members, work collaboratively with accounts, digital and (where applicable) strategy teams to deliver various projects and deliverables.

Navigate client feedback and working with the team to execute this.

Where required, work into established brands to tweak/refresh the visual identity.

Their experience would include:

2-3 years experience in a similar role or agency.

Keen to develop design skills and knowledge.

Positive attitude when it comes to challenge and change – client input very much seen as an opportunity to improve the overall output.

Confident to proactively seek feedback and ask questions.

Desire to expand knowledge of brand systems and work with a large scale client.

Proactivity – actively seeking to add value to the work/team/client.

Ability to use (or willingness to learn) collaborative and presentation deck building tools (e.g. Figma, Miro, Pitch) to collaborate with the wider team.

Experience creating brand collateral across digital and print.

Solid knowledge across Creative su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ator)

Ability to work on multiple tasks from week to week.

Used to working to client deadlines.

Keen eye for detail.

About us:

Fold7 is an independent, creative company that has built its reputation by growing evolving and emerging brands.

Our vision is to gather an extraordinary bunch of trailblazers who want to make outstanding work with ambitious clients such as Carlsberg Group, Amazon/Audible, Capital One, PZ Cussons, NatWest/Mettle, Kallo and CoppaFeel!

Whilst we have consistently delivered acclaimed social output across campaigns over the past decade, we are experiencing a rising demand for social and digitally led projects from existing and brand-new clients. We have recently invested in industry-leading talent across digital innovation, strategy, social creative and production. 

From the minute you walk into the agency, people notice the warm welcome and the sense of feeling like home. Add to that the beautiful architecture and thoughtful curation of our building, and we have a wonderful place to create great work for our clients and enjoy the time we spend with one another.

Fold7 works a hybrid working model where some days can be worked from home, and others from our offices in London EC1. Our current working pattern is Tuesday – Thursday in the office and Mondays and Fridays working from anywhere.

Wellbeing

We are committed to conscious inclusion that creates an ethos of connection, belonging and shared purpose. We open our doors to others who share our values. We think about our people holistically and know the value of bringing our whole selves to work. It is why we developed a well-being programme, not just for our physical health but also for our mental wellbeing.

Doing work at the level we deliver is exhilarating. It is also demanding and requires every ounce of creativity, ambition and skill. With this in mind, we avoid meetings in the diary between 1-2PM, and encourage no emails after 8PM and before 8AM. Our generosity island, in the heart of the agency, is where Foldsters leave post-holiday gifts and home-baked goods for us all to share. It’s also used for light- hearted fun to break up the working day. We use our upstairs bar / café for quiet working in the day, or pub quiz nights, pre-party games and challenges. Drinks every Thursday at 5pm in the bar signals the end of our working days in the agency before our Fridays working from anywhere, with the occasional FlipCup challenges and Carlsberg on tap.

We organise a quarterly Book Club and offer Tate and The Design Museum memberships to employees. When life is so busy, how about yoga lunchtime classes in the agency. We work with a qualified practitioner and cover the cost, so that all energy is focussed on your well-being. If yoga isn’t your thing, then starting the day with a kick-boxing class might be the answer.
